在前端开发中,我们经常需要在页面中使用一些第三方的 JavaScript 库或插件。而要使用这些库或插件,我们通常需要手动下载、引入和管理它们,这会让我们的工作变得复杂且容易出错。npm 包管理工具可以帮助我们更好地管理这些库或插件,而 brbower 就是一个可以让我们方便使用 npm 包的工具。
brbower 是什么?
brbower 是一个简单的 npm 包,用于在前端项目中使用 bower 包。它提供了一些列命令行工具,可以让我们方便地使用 bower 包,同时还可以与 npm 构建工具兼容,让我们的开发过程更加高效。
安装 brbower
首先,我们需要在本地安装 brbower。在终端中执行以下命令:
npm install -g brbower
安装完成后,我们就可以开始使用 brbower 了。
使用 brbower 安装 bower 包
使用 brbower 安装 bower 包非常简单。首先,我们需要在项目的根目录下创建一个 bower.json
文件,用于记录项目所需的 bower 包。例如:
{ "name": "my-project", "version": "1.0.0", "dependencies": { "jquery": "^3.6.0", "bootstrap": "^4.6.0" } }
在这个例子中,我们希望安装 jquery 和 bootstrap 这两个 bower 包。
接下来,我们执行以下命令:
brbower install
brbower 会读取项目中的 bower.json
文件,并自动安装所需的 bower 包到 bower_components
目录中。
引用 bower 包
安装完成后,我们可以在 HTML 文件中直接引用这些 bower 包:
-- -------------------- ---- ------- --------- ----- ------ ------ ----- ---------------- --------- --------------- ----- ---------------- ------------------------------------------------------------- ------- ------ ---------- ----------- ------- ---------------------------------------------------------- ------- ------------------------------------------------------------------- ------- -------
这些 bower 包现在都可以被我们的项目所使用了。
导出 bower 包
如果我们在本地修改了某个 bower 包,我们可以使用 brbower 来将其导出为 npm 包:
brbower export [package-name]
这个命令会将 bower_components/[package-name]
目录下的文件打包成 npm 包,在项目根目录下创建一个 npm
目录,并将打包后的 npm 包放到其中。
总结
使用 brbower 可以让我们方便地使用 bower 包,在前端开发中提高开发效率和工作质量。如果你在前端开发中使用了大量的 bower 包,那么 brbower 就是一个非常实用的工具。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066c86ccdc64669dde4f54